How the session runs.
approx. 90 min / 4 stepsLay plants onto a cotton tenugui handkerchief.
Roll the cloth around a rod and tie it with string.
Steam it just as it is, for 45 to 50 minutes.
Let it cool, untie the string and open the cloth out. This is the moment the colour and shape of the plants appear on it.
Happa to Hana Some eco print transfers the shape of a plant onto cloth. You dye plants onto a cotton tenugui handkerchief.
You lay the plants onto the cloth, roll it around a rod, tie it with string and steam it just as it is. When the steaming is done you untie the string and open the cloth out — and until that moment you cannot see how it has turned out, which is half the pleasure. Finding the colour a plant was holding all along is a thrill for adults and children alike.
There is a bonus that only a collaboration can offer: while your eco print is steaming, you can try the fresh-leaf indigo dyeing running alongside it with Arimatsu greening. The indigo growing in front of Arimatsu Station has come through weeks of 40°C heat in fine health, and the session begins by picking its leaves — everything after that is done by hand.
